Objective: To use metagenomic sequencing to compare the differences in intestinal microbiota species and metabolic pathways in patients with hepatitis B cirrhosis with or without ascites and further explore the correlation between the differential microbiota and clinical indicators and metabolic pathways. Methods: 20 hepatitis B cirrhosis cases [10 without ascites (HBLC-WOA), 10 with ascites (HBLC-WA), and 5 healthy controls (HC)] were selected from the previously studied 16S rRNA samples. Metagenome sequencing was performed on the intestinal microbiota samples. The Kruskal-Wallis rank sum test and Spearman test were used to identify and analyse differential intestinal microbiota populations, metabolic pathways, and their correlations. Results: (1) The overall structure of the intestinal microbiota differed significantly among the three groups (R = 0.19, P = 0.018). The HC group had the largest abundance of Firmicutes and the lowest abundance of Proteobacteria at the genus level. Firmicutes abundance was significantly decreased (P(fdr) < 0.01), while Proteobacteria abundance was significantly increased (P(fdr) < 0.01) in patients with cirrhosis accompanied by ascites; (2) LEfSe analysis revealed that 29 intestinal microbiota (18 in the HBLC-WA group and 11 in the HBLC-WOA group) played a significant role in the disease group. The unclassified Enterobacteriaceae and Klebsiella species in the HBLC-WA group and Enterobacteriaceae in the HBLC-WOA group were positively correlated with the Child-Turcotte-Pugh (CTP) score, prothrombin time, and international normalized ratio score and negatively correlated with albumin and hemoglobin levels (P < 0.05). Escherichia and Shigella in the HBLC-WA group were positively correlated with CTP scores (P < 0.05); (3) The correlation analysis results between the KEGG pathway and 29 specific intestinal microbiota revealed that Enterobacteriaceae and arachidonic acid, α-linolenic acid, glycerolipid metabolism, and fatty acid degradation were positively correlated in the lipid metabolism pathway, while most Enterobacteriaceae were positively correlated with branched-chain amino acid degradation and negatively correlated with aromatic amino acid biosynthesis in the amino acid metabolic pathway. Conclusion: A significant increment of Enterobacteriaceae in the intestines of HBLC-WA patients influenced hepatic reserve function and was associated with amino acid and lipid metabolic pathways. Therefore, attention should be paid to controlling the intestinal microbiota to prevent complications and improve the prognosis in patients with hepatitis B cirrhosis, especially in those with ascites.

To generate an efficient tool used in Xenopus oocyte expression for in situ investigation of channel receptor expression, distribution and function, the C-terminus of the honeybee (Apis mellifera L.) resistant to dieldrin (RDL) subunit was fused with *FP, including monomeric red, enhanced yellow or enhanced green fluorescent protein (referred to as mRFP, EYFP and EGFP, respectively). In the present study, all fused *FP-AmRDLs could be visualized using fluorescence and laser confocal microscopy in cRNA-injected oocytes. Fluorescence was distributed isotropically in the cellular membrane. The potencies of the agonist γ-aminobutyric acid (GABA), but not ß-alanine, and the test antagonists (fipronil, flufiprole, dieldrin, α-endosulfan, bifenazate and avermectin B1a) in the *FP-AmRDL receptor did not significantly differ from that of the untagged receptor with two-electrode voltage clamp detection. The half maximal effective concentrations (EC50 s) of GABA in AmRDL, EGFP-AmRDL, EYFP-AmRDL and mRFP-AmRDL receptors were 11.98, 12.61, 18.92 and 22.11 µM, respectively, and those of ß-alanine were 651.6, 629.6, 1643.0 and 2146.0 µM, respectively. Inhibition percentages of test antagonists against *FP-AmRDL and AmRDL were not significantly different from each other. Overall, the consistency in functional properties between *FP-AmRDL and AmRDL receptors makes pGH19-*FP a promising tool for further in situ investigation of GABA receptors.

Portal vein thrombosis refers to the formation of a thrombus in the trunk of the portal vein and /or its branches due to various causes, and is one of the common complications of cirrhosis. Synthesizing the existing evidence, this paper summaries the cirrhosis with portal vein thrombosis in terms of epidemiology, etiology, pathophysiology, risk factors, definition and classification, clinical manifestations and complications, diagnosis and screening, treatment, follow-up and prognosis, prospects and problems.

BACKGROUND AND AIMS: The function of interleukin (IL)-10-producing B cells (B10 cell) is compromised in patients with allergic diseases. Protease-activated receptor (PAR)-2 has immunoregulatory functions. This study aimed to elucidate the role of PAR2 in the suppression of IL-10 expression in peripheral B cells. METHODS: Peripheral blood B cells were collected from patients with allergic rhinitis (AR). A correlation between the expression of Bcl2-like protein 12 (Bcl2L12) and IL-10 in the B cells was analyzed. An AR mouse model was developed. RESULTS: We observed that the expression of IL-10 was lower in the peripheral B cells from patients with airway allergy. A negative correlation was identified between the expression of IL-10 and PAR2 in B cells. Activation of PAR2 of B cells increased the expression of Bcl2L12 and suppression of LPS-induced IL-10 expression, which were inhibited by knocking down the Bcl2L12 gene. Treating B cells from AR patients with Bcl2L12-shRNA-carrying liposomes reversed the capability of IL-10 expression and the immunosuppressive function. Administration of Bcl2L12 shRNA-carrying liposomes attenuated experimental AR in mice. CONCLUSIONS: Activation of PAR2 inhibits the expression of IL-10 in B cells, which can be reversed by treating B cells with Bcl2L12 shRNA-carrying liposomes. The data suggest that regulation of Bcl2L12 may be a novel approach in the treatment for AR.

The ryanodine receptor (RyR) of the calcium release channel is the main target of anthranilic and phthalic diamide insecticides which have high selective insecticidal activity relative to mammalian toxicity. In this study, the full-length cDNA of Chilo suppressalis RyR (CsRyR) was isolated and characterized. The CsRyR mRNA has an open reading frame (ORF) of 15,387bp nucleotides, which encodes 5128 amino acids with GenBank ID: KR088972. Comparison of protein sequences showed that CsRyR shared high identities with other insects of 77-96% and lower identity to mammals and nematodes with only 42-45%. One alternative splicing site (KENLG) unique to Lepidoptera was found and two exclusive exons of CsRyR (I /II) were revealed. Spatial and temporal expression of CsRyR mRNA was at the highest relative level in 3rd instar larvae and head (including brain and muscle), and at the lowest expression level in egg and fat body. The expression levels of whole body CsRyR mRNA were increased remarkably after injection of 4th instar larvae with chlorantraniliprole at 0.004 to 0.4µg/g. This structural and functional information on CsRyR provides the basis for further understanding the selective action of chlorantraniliprole and possibly other diamide insecticides.

Objective: To investigate the effect of Fuzheng Huayu capsules on the survival rate of patients with liver cirrhosis. Methods: A retrospective analysis was performed for the clinical data of the patients with various types of liver cirrhosis who were hospitalized in Shuguang Hospital Affiliated to Shanghai University of Traditional Chinese Medicine from January 1, 2006 to December 31, 2008. The data collected for these patients included their basic information, diagnosis and treatment, and results of laboratory examination. The Kaplan-Meier method was used to analyze the effect of Fuzheng Huayu capsules on the survival rate of patients with liver cancer. The starting point of observation was the first day of the patient's admission and the ending point of follow-up observation was the date of death or the end of follow-up April 1, 2014. The cut-off value was obtained if the patient did not experience any outcome event (death) at the end of follow-up. With reference to the outcome, the time when the outcome occurred, and the cut-off value, the life-table method was used to calculate survival rates and survival curves were plotted. The Kaplan-Meier product-limit method was used to calculate the arithmetic mean of survival time and median survival time, and the log-rank test was used to compare the survival data. Results: A total of 430 patients with liver cirrhosis were enrolled, among whom 191 died and 239 survived or were censored. The average constituent ratio of death was 55.6% and the average constituent ratio of survival was 44.4%. The life-table method showed that the half-, 1-, 2-, and 5-year survival rates were 70%, 64%, 58%, and 48%, respectively. The median survival time was 112.1 weeks for the patients who did not take Fuzheng Huayu capsules and 351.6 weeks for those who did, and there was a significant difference in survival rate between the two groups (P = 0.000). Among 313 patients who had an etiology of hepatitis B, 164 did not take Fuzheng Huayu capsules and had a median survival time of 195.9 weeks and a 5-year survival rate of 44%, and 149 took Fuzheng Huayu capsules and had a median survival time of 336.9 weeks and a 5-year survival rate of 59%; there was a significant difference in survival rate between the two groups (P = 0.038). Among 117 patients who did not have hepatitis B, 68 did not take Fuzheng Huayu capsules and had a median survival time of 78.1 weeks and a 5-year survival rate of 32%, and 49 took Fuzheng Huayu capsules and had a median survival time of 277.4 weeks and a 5-year survival rate of 53%; there was a significant difference in survival rate between the two groups (P = 0.013). Among 92 patients with compensated liver cirrhosis, 47 did not take Fuzheng Huayu capsules and had a 5-year survival rate of 65%, and 45 took Fuzheng Huayu capsules and had a 5-year survival rate of 82%; both groups of patients had a median survival of 440 weeks; there was a significant difference in survival rate between the two groups (P = 0.027). Among 338 patients with decompensated liver cirrhosis, 185 did not take Fuzheng Huayu capsules and had a median survival time of 60.3 weeks and a 5-year survival rate of 33%, and 153 took Fuzheng Huayu capsules and had a median survival time of 267.7 weeks and a 5-year survival rate of 51%; there was a significant difference in survival rate between the two groups (P = 0.001). Conclusion: Fuzheng Huayu capsules can improve the prognosis of patients with liver cirrhosis and increase their survival rates and have good long-term efficacy.

To evaluate the genotype-phenotype relationship of Gitelman syndrome in Chinese patients. We selected patients with Gitelman syndrome presenting hypokalemia. Medical history, clinical manifestations, laboratory test results, and imaging data of these patients were collected for analysis. Target gene sequencing was performed to evaluate the genotype-phenotype relationship. Gitelman syndrome was diagnosed based on medical history, clinical manifestations, laboratory test results, and imaging data. The causative gene for Gitelman syndrome, SLC12A3, and the causative gene for the classic Bartter syndrome, CLCNKB, were screened for disease-causing mutations by direct sequencing. Clinical diagnoses of ten patients were consistent with Gitelman syndrome. Disease-causing mutations in the SLC12A3 gene were found in six patients. Among the variants, T60M in exon 1 was the hot spot in Chinese patients. Additionally, we found a small deletion of ACGG in exon 3 and L671P in exon 16; these have not been reported in previous studies. No disease-causing mutations were observed in the other four patients. Since mutations in the SLC12A3 and CLCNKB genes are not present in all patients with clinical manifestations of Gitelman syndrome, genetic screening after clinical diagnosis is essential.

The genes of top athletes are a valuable genetic resource for the human race, and could be exploited to identify novel genes related to sports ability, as well as other functions. We analyzed the expressed sequence tags from top half-pipe snowboarding athletes using the SMART complementary DNA (cDNA) library construction method to elucidate the characteristics of the athlete genome and the differential expression of the genes it contains. Overall, we established a full-length cDNA library from the lymphocytes of half-pipe snowboarding athletes and analyzed the inserted gene fragments. We also classified those genes according to molecular function, biological characteristics, cellular composition, protein types, and signal paths. A total of 201 functional genes were noted, which were distributed in 27 pathways. TXN, MDH1, ARL1, ARPC3, ACTG1, and other genes measured in sequence may be associated with physical ability. This suggests that the SMART cDNA library constructed from the genetic material from top athletes is an effective tool for preserving genetic sports resources and providing genetic markers of physical ability for athlete selection.

The latest research findings on bidirectional regulation of neuro-immunity through traditional neural circuits shed new light on the theoretical basis of the role of vidian neurectomy (VN). This article aims to provide a comprehensive understanding of VN, including the history of VN, the principle of neuroimmuno-interaction, the applied anatomy of VN as well as the methods of transnasal endoscopic surgery. Additionally, we introduce the concept of the nose-brain axis, which was proposed based on the advancement in the area of neuro-immune interactions.

Objective: To summarize clinical features and our experience of the diagnosis and treatment of laryngocele. Methods: Clinical data of 11 laryngocele patients in department of Otorhinolaryngology Head and Neck Surgery of the Second Affiliated Hospital of Shanxi Medical University from January 2012 to December 2021 were retrospectively reviewed, including 9 men and 2 women, aged from 12 to 75 years, with median age of 56 years. Electronic laryngoscope was performed in 10 of all patients, laryngeal CT in 10 and cervical color ultrasound in 5 before operation.All the operations were performed under general anesthesia, and the external cervical approach was used for external and combined laryngocele. The internal laryngocele was resected by low temperature plasma through transoral endoscopy. Patients were followed up regularly after operation to evaluate the effect. Clinical feature, types of lesions, imaging findings, surgical approaches and follow-up results were analyzed through descriptive statistical method. Results: Eleven laryngocele patients were divided into mixed type (n=6), internal type (n=4) and external type (n=1).Nine patients presented with hoarseness or dysphonia, 7 with cervical mass and 1 with airway obstruction. Surgical resections were done through external cervical approach (n=7)or transoral endoscopic approach (n=4). All the operations were successful and no complication occurred. All cases were followed up from 17 to 110 months. No recurrence was encountered. Conclusions: Laryngocele is a rare lesion with atypical clinical presentation. Preoperative imaging including CT scan and electronic laryngoscope is essential to evaluate the location, and extent of the lesion, and to make the surgical plan.Complete surgical excision is required. Surgical resection is the only effective method for the treatment of laryngocele.

Objective: This cross-sectional investigation aimed to determine the incidence, clinical characteristics, prognosis, and related risk factors of olfactory and gustatory dysfunctions related to infection with the SARS-CoV-2 Omicron strain in mainland China. Methods: Data of patients with SARS-CoV-2 from December 28, 2022, to February 21, 2023, were collected through online and offline questionnaires from 45 tertiary hospitals and one center for disease control and prevention in mainland China. The questionnaire included demographic information, previous health history, smoking and alcohol drinking, SARS-CoV-2 vaccination, olfactory and gustatory function before and after infection, other symptoms after infection, as well as the duration and improvement of olfactory and gustatory dysfunction. The self-reported olfactory and gustatory functions of patients were evaluated using the Olfactory VAS scale and Gustatory VAS scale. Results: A total of 35 566 valid questionnaires were obtained, revealing a high incidence of olfactory and taste dysfunctions related to infection with the SARS-CoV-2 Omicron strain (67.75%). Females(χ2=367.013, P<0.001) and young people(χ2=120.210, P<0.001) were more likely to develop these dysfunctions. Gender(OR=1.564, 95%CI: 1.487-1.645), SARS-CoV-2 vaccination status (OR=1.334, 95%CI: 1.164-1.530), oral health status (OR=0.881, 95%CI: 0.839-0.926), smoking history (OR=1.152, 95%CI=1.080-1.229), and drinking history (OR=0.854, 95%CI: 0.785-0.928) were correlated with the occurrence of olfactory and taste dysfunctions related to SARS-CoV-2(above P<0.001). 44.62% (4 391/9 840) of the patients who had not recovered their sense of smell and taste also suffered from nasal congestion, runny nose, and 32.62% (3 210/9 840) suffered from dry mouth and sore throat. The improvement of olfactory and taste functions was correlated with the persistence of accompanying symptoms(χ2=10.873, P=0.001). The average score of olfactory and taste VAS scale was 8.41 and 8.51 respectively before SARS-CoV-2 infection, but decreased to3.69 and 4.29 respectively after SARS-CoV-2 infection, and recovered to 5.83and 6.55 respectively at the time of the survey. The median duration of olfactory and gustatory dysfunctions was 15 days and 12 days, respectively, with 0.5% (121/24 096) of patients experiencing these dysfunctions for more than 28 days. The overall self-reported improvement rate of smell and taste dysfunctions was 59.16% (14 256/24 096). Gender(OR=0.893, 95%CI: 0.839-0.951), SARS-CoV-2 vaccination status (OR=1.334, 95%CI: 1.164-1.530), history of head and facial trauma(OR=1.180, 95%CI: 1.036-1.344, P=0.013), nose (OR=1.104, 95%CI: 1.042-1.171, P=0.001) and oral (OR=1.162, 95%CI: 1.096-1.233) health status, smoking history(OR=0.765, 95%CI: 0.709-0.825), and the persistence of accompanying symptoms (OR=0.359, 95%CI: 0.332-0.388) were correlated with the recovery of olfactory and taste dysfunctions related to SARS-CoV-2 (above P<0.001 except for the indicated values). Conclusion: The incidence of olfactory and taste dysfunctions related to infection with the SARS-CoV-2 Omicron strain is high in mainland China, with females and young people more likely to develop these dysfunctions. Active and effective intervention measures may be required for cases that persist for a long time. The recovery of olfactory and taste functions is influenced by several factors, including gender, SARS-CoV-2 vaccination status, history of head and facial trauma, nasal and oral health status, smoking history, and persistence of accompanying symptoms.

Objective: To investigate the clinical and pathological features, treatments and prognosis of laryngeal neuroendocrine carcinoma (LNEC). Methods: We conducted the retrospective analysis of the clinical data of 12 patients with LNEC admitted to the Department of Otorhinolaryngology Head and Neck Surgery, Second Hospital of Shanxi Medical University from May 2014 to December 2021, including 9 males and 3 females, aged 50-77 years. There were 4 cases of typical carcinoid tumour (highly differentiated), 5 cases of atypical carcinoid tumour (moderately differentiated) and 3 cases of neuroendocrine small cell carcinoma (hypofractionated). The clinical features, diagnosis, treatment and prognosis of LNEC were analysed. Results: The clinical manifestations of LNEC varied according to the tumour type but did not correlate with the pathological types. The supraglottic type was characterized by sore throat, foreign body sensation in the pharynx, coughing, obstructive sensation when eating and choking on water. The treatments were determined according to the pathological types, lesion location and invasion scope. Of 12 patients 4 underwent horizontal partial laryngectomy plus elective lymphatic dissection plus postoperative radiotherapy/chemotherapy, 4 underwent vertical partial laryngectomy (3 of them with cervical lymphatic dissection), 3 underwent supported laryngoscopic plasma laryngectomy for laryngeal cancer, and 1 abandoned for treatment. With the follow-up of 8 -78 months, 5 patients were alive, 1 died from chemotherapy reactions, 3 died from other diseases, 1 died from lung metastasis, 1 died from lung infection and 1 was lost to follow-up. Conclusion: LNEC is clinically rare, the clinical manifestations are less specificity, diagnosis relies on pathological and immunohistochemical examinations, and treatment modalities and prognoses are closely related to the pathological subtypes of LNEC.

BACKGROUND: Specific immunotherapy (SIT) is the only curable remedy for allergic disorders currently; however, the underlying mechanism is not fully understood yet. This study aimed to elucidate the mechanism of SIT on suppressing TIM4 (T cell immunoglobulin mucin domain molecule 4) expression in dendritic cells (DCs) and modulating the skewed T helper 2 (Th2) responses in patients with airway allergy. METHODS: Twenty patients with allergic rhinitis (AR) were treated with SIT for 3 months. Before and after SIT, the expression of TIM4 in peripheral DC and TIM1 in Th2 cells was examined. The role of Fc gamma receptor (FcgammaR) I and II in modulating the expression of TIM4 in DCs was investigated. RESULTS: The interaction of TIM1/TIM4 played a critical role in sustaining the polarization status of Th2 cells in AR patients. Cross-linking FcgammaRI by antigen/IgG complexes increased the production of TIM4 by dendritic cells via upregulating tumor necrosis factor-alpha in DCs. Exposure to microbial products promoted the expression of FcgammaRI in DCs that further increased the expression of TIM4. Exposure to specific antigens alone upregulated the expression of FcgammaRII in DCs, that suppressed the expression of TIM4. CONCLUSIONS: We conclude that SIT suppresses the skewed Th2 responses via disrupting the interaction of TIM1/TIM4 in antigen-specific Th2 cells.
